LexisNexis is described as 'Group is a corporation providing computer-assisted legal research as well as business research and risk management services. During the 1970s, LexisNexis pioneered the electronic accessibility of legal and journalistic documents' and is an app in the education & reference category.   4. An open source database of international sanctions targets, politicians and other persons of interest. Data can be downloaded in bulk or searched via the site, and will help investigators find leads for illicit activity and let companies manage risk.
